Here we compared two budget smartphones: the 6.6-inch Samsung Galaxy A13 (with Exynos 850) that was released on March 4, 2022, against the Motorola Moto G13, which is powered by Mediatek Helio G85 and came out 11 months after. Key differences

An overview of the main advantages of each smartphone
Reasons to consider the Samsung Galaxy A13
  • 48% higher pixel density (400 vs 270 PPI)
  • More energy-efficient CPU – Exynos 850
  • Has an ultra-wide angle camera lens
  • 10% faster in single-core GeekBench 6 test: 474 and 431 points
  • The front-facing camera can record video at 1080p
Reasons to consider the Motorola Moto G13
  • Higher display refresh rate – 90 Hz
  • Newer Bluetooth version (v5.1)
  • 22% better performance in AnTuTu Benchmark (262K versus 215K)
  • Stereo speakers
  • The phone is 11-months newer

Conclusion

If the camera, battery life, and software are more important to you, then choose the Samsung Galaxy A13 . But if the design and sound are more of a priority – go for the Motorola Moto G13 .
